无法找到或加载主类BasicApp.Application

时间:2016-02-06 08:51:18

标签: java spring maven spring-boot

我是春季启动的新手,并试图在春季启动时创建一个非常基本的应用程序。但是,我在创建应用程序时遇到此错误。

  

无法找到或加载主类BasicApp.Application

我的应用程序有两个类{1}}类和一个Controller类。这是我的代码:

Application.java

Main

MainController.java

package BasicApp;

import org.springframework.boot.SpringApplication;

public class Application
{
    public static void main(String[] args) {

        SpringApplication.run(Application.class, args);
    }
}

的pom.xml

package BasicApp;

import org.springframework.boot.autoconfigure.EnableAutoConfiguration;
import org.springframework.stereotype.Controller;
import org.springframework.web.bind.annotation.RequestMapping;
import org.springframework.web.bind.annotation.ResponseBody;

@Controller
@EnableAutoConfiguration
public class MainController 
{
    @RequestMapping("/send")
    @ResponseBody
    public String sendMessage()
    {
        return("M sending message");
    }
}

有人可以帮我解决这个错误吗?

2 个答案:

答案 0 :(得分:1)

将@SpringBootApplication注释放到Application类中,它将为您完成所有配置。

答案 1 :(得分:0)

看到构建错误,通常文件大小为零,删除maven文件夹中的坏文件